A new anisotropic permanent magnet was developed in the Mn-Al-C system, using warm-plastic deformation, with following magnetic properties : Br = 6100 G, bHc 2700 Oe and (BH)max 7.0 MG-Oe. This has good machinability that it can be shaped drilled a lathe while phase state. The particular characteristics of system were investigated as to carbon concentration. It found that, order obtain excellent properties, concentration must exceed its solubility limit (τ-phase).

An anisotropic polycrystalline magnet of a Mn‐Al‐C alloy with (BH) max=6 MG⋅Oe has been successfully produced by extrusion at about 700°C. During the study on this ternary system, ferromagnetic phase (τ‐phase) single crystal was obtained annealing high‐temperature (ε‐phase) containing lamellae compound Mn3AlC, under action uniaxial compressive stress. The formation process τ‐phase analyzed. can be explained ε (h.c.p.) →ε′ (orthorhomb.) →τ (f.c.t.) transformations following orientation...
